Abstract: Copper-oxide superconductors were discovered over a decade ago, but the high value of their superconducting transition temperature,Tc, has remained a mystery. A new tool for measuring the long-range phase coherence — essential for superconductivity — of high-Tcmaterials may provide a route to the answer.
